Fun With Ribbon Scraps

Hi, guys!  Hope all is well.  I thought I would share with you a card I made for A Cut Above, the online card class by Jennifer McGuire and friends.  It is such a great class filled with so much fun and content. I made this card using some scraps of ribbons I have been saving.  I never thought to use ribbon with my die cuts before.


Supplies:
Paper: Gina K Designs White, Echo Park 
Ink: Adirondack Pesto
Stamps: Stampin' Up Canvas background and Stem
Misc.: Scraps of ribbons, Papertrey Ink button, Twine
Die: Tattered Floral-Alterations

This was a fun card to make.  I have a hard time tossing ribbon scraps out, so now I have some fun uses for them.

Creative Chemistry 101 - The Finale

Hi, guys!  I hope you all had a great weekend.  I enjoyed it very much as I was able to complete the rest of my tags for the Tim Holtz Creative Chemistry 101 class.  I thought I would share them with you now.

Day 6:  Watercolor with Markers, Blending with Markers, Stamping with Markers


Day 7:  Nostalgic Batik , Rusted Enamel, Distress Powder Resist


Day 8:  Paint Dabber Resist, Crackle Paint Resist, Shattered Stains


Day 9:  Perfect Distress Mist, Perfect Distress, Perfect Splatter Distress


Day 10:  Rock Candy Distress Stickles


This class was full of great techniques and insights.  I highly recommend that anyone who would like to learn how to use the Ranger line of products sign up for this course.  The helpful hints Tim gives you are worth their weight in gold.  It is apparent that Tim really loves what he does and encourages you to stretch yourself and your creativity.  I found some of the techniques I will use over and over, and others I will pull out when I need to try something different and have some play time.  One thing I came away with from the class is that if I have an idea, I should just try it.  It may work, or it may not, but if it does, it can be great!
